問題タブ [object-relational-model]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
python - SQLAlchemy ORMをSQLコア式のオブジェクトと接続しますか?
ORMは「更新して返す」ことができないため、SQLalchemyコア式を使用してオブジェクトをフェッチする必要があります。(ORM の更新にはありませんreturning
)
いつ
報告しUnmappedInstanceError: Class 'sqlalchemy.engine.result.RowProxy' is not mapped
ます。
RowProxy
そのオブジェクトをSQL式からORMのIDマップに入れるにはどうすればよいですか?
sql - Oracleのネストした表の参照
次のテーブル構造があります。
ネストされたテーブルOrdersを持つテーブルCustomerと、ネストされたテーブルPositionsをOrdersの属性として持つ。
Positionsの 1 つの属性はArtNrです。属性ArtNrを持つTable Articleもあります。そして、それらの 2 つの属性は互いに関係にあります。
私の問題は:
- それらはオブジェクトテーブルであるため、外部キーを使用できません -> オブジェクト参照を使用する必要があります (ref)
- しかし、参照を定義する必要がある場所が正確にはわかりません( ArticleまたはCustomer ?)
- refのOracle構文に問題があります
python - Python SQLAlchemy での ORM 関係の定義
私は2つのモデルを持っていAnimals
ますSpecies
。anAnimals
は 1 にのみ関連付けることができ、同じ に属するSpecies
複数が存在する可能性があります。Animals
Species
たとえば、bobby
はAnimals
オブジェクトに属するbear
Species
オブジェクトです。
オブジェクトを取得するためにAnimals
使用できるように、モデルでORM 関係をどのように定義すればよいでしょうか?bobby.species
bear
Species
また、この関係は 1 対 1 と呼ばれますか?